The Lair.

Taking a cue from Little Shop of Horrors, the second season of the popular horror/suspense series, The Lair, introduces us to a mysteriously murdering plant. In addition, stars Colton Ford, David Moretti, and newcomer Johnny Hazard romp with sexy vampires and werewolves. What could be gayer? Oh . . . maybe Top Design. Returns September 5 on here!
